Frentzen Ready for Century GP and Fatherhood

Friday April 7th, 2000

Heinz-Harald Frentzen grabbed the first win of his Formula One career at the 1997 San Marino Grand Prix and on Sunday he hopes to mark his 100th race by repeating that feat. 

The German, whose wife Tanja is expecting their first child at any time, believes he needs only a small change of luck to grab his first win of the season for Jordan. 

"Last year, I was very unlucky here becase I spun off the track on oil left by Eddie Irvine's car and so, this time, I want to have a dose of better luck. I would love to celebrate my 100th race with a podium or a win." 

Frentzen took a step towards that achievement by clocking the fourth best time in Friday's opening free practice session. 

"I felt it was a good first day and I am happy how it went. The car felt good," he said. "We had no problems at all and we were able to do a lot of work on the set-up which is important. For me, the car felt good right from the start and that is always a good signal. 

"I think I am in good shape for the weekend. I just hope it delivers some reward."
